Overview:
The primary duty of the Oncology Data Specialist is to document patient cancer diagnoses as recorded by medical professionals working within Cone Health. This position is integral in supporting the evolution of cancer programs, ensuring that data reporting requirements are met, and functioning as an essential repository of information regarding cancer with the key objective of preventing and managing the condition.
The role entails a time commitment of 10-15 hours each week for part-time employment.
Responsibilities:
Effectively condenses a diverse array of medical data sourced from Electronic Medical Records (EMR) and translates it into standardized codes that align with established data conventions, all in accordance with organizational policies.
Assists in validating the entirety and precision of data collected or documented by physicians, hospital personnel, or staff members in a doctor's office.
Evaluates benchmarking reports with guidance and engages in discussions with quality data owners and customers from various sectors within the department, hospital system, and providers to enhance comprehension of the data and its acquisition processes.
Advocates for the use of data collection software like Premier, Digital Innovation Registries, and possible alternative vendors.
Takes part in the advancement and execution of quality management procedures.
Supports in confirming if assigned cases are reportable while working directly under supervision.
Executes tasks as delegated.
